does anyone remember when Gary Payton came into the league? Though he had a world of physical ability, he couldn't keep anyone honest with his jumper. The D would slump into the paint and dare him to shoot. It wasn't until his 3rd year in the league that he shored up this weakness to an acceptable level... the rest is history. http://www.basketball-reference.com/players/p/paytoga01.html It's not a given that Jerryd's jumper improves a similar amount, but if he can bring it up he will be a very tough combo guard for anyone to handle. If he can't improve this weakness it will continue to limit his effectiveness and minutes no matter where he's playing. Jerryd came into the league 2 years younger then GP. Gary Payton had the added advantage of being a better playmaker and an elite defender. I don't even dislike Bayless, I just don't think that it's super likely that his particular set of skills are going to mesh all that well longterm. He's got a first or second option mentality, with a 4th option role, and his distribution and set up skills aren't great enough to compensate for when his jumper goes cold or when opponents shut down the paint. Maybe he makes some big leaps in the next year or two (which would be great) but currently he's just not a good enough threat from outside, nor a good enough distributor to be much more than a change of pace scoring guard, when the Blazers are in the bonus.
